The newest focus area, ServSafe Workplace, is an online-only course without a testing component that deals with workplace harassment and bias. The ServSafe program is administered by the National Restaurant Association, which makes training and testing materials available. ServSafe certification is accepted nationwide in the United States. A chef sanitized a thermometer probe and then checked the temperature of minestrone soup being held in a hot-holding unit. The temperature was 120°F (49°C), which did not meet the operation's critical limit of 135°F (57°C). The chef recorded the temperature in the log and reheated the soup to 165°F (74°C) for 15 seconds. Each student will need a ServSafe Exam Answer Sheet or a ServSafe Exam Access Code to take the ServSafe Manager Certification Examination. Exam Answer Sheets can be purchased separately or with a textbook. An Exam Access Code is a unique code that verifies you have purchased an online exam and allows access to take the online exam. They are: 1) Foodborne Microorganisms & Allergens. 2) Personal Hygiene. 3) Purchasing, Receiving and Storage. 4) Preparation, Cooking, and Serving. 5) Facilities, Cleaning/Sanitizing, and Pest …The three major types of contaminants are biological, chemical, and physical. Biological contaminants include bacteria, viruses, parasites, and fungi. Chemical contaminants include foodservice chemicals such as cleaners, sanitizers, and polishes.
